<h4>INTRODUCTORY PARAGRAPH</h4> Characterization of the cardiac cellulome—the network of cells that form the heart—is essential for understanding cardiac development and normal organ function, and for formulating precise therapeutic strategies to combat heart disease. Recent studies have challenged assumptions about both the cellular composition 1 and functional significance of the cardiac non-myocyte cell pool,...
